Rancho Santa Librada TrafficRancho Santa Librada WeatherRancho Santa Librada Petrol StationsRancho Santa Librada HotelsRancho Santa Librada RestaurantsRancho Santa Librada Car RepairRancho Santa Librada more services
Rancho Santa Librada City Info
2025-12-10
Roadnow
Let's chat about Rancho Santa Librada
2025-12-10
Guest
